Q. Consider the following statements.
I. Sodium dichromate is less soluble than potassium dichromate.
II. Crystals of potassium dichromate are of orange colour.
III. The chromates and dichromates are interconvertible in aqueous solution depending upon $pH$ of the solution.
IV. The oxidation state of chromate and dichromate is different.
The correct statements are

The d-and f-Block Elements

Solution:

Sodium dichromate is less soluble than potassium dichromate. Colour of sodium dichromate and potassium dichromate is orange. The chromates and dichromates are interconvertible in aqueous solution depending upon $pH$ of the solution. The oxidation state of chromate and dichromate is same.
